The Hidden Costs of Unchecked Scope Creep
Software development projects operate on tight financial and temporal boundaries. When clients introduce new requirements mid-cycle, the immediate reaction often prioritizes relationship preservation over financial analysis. This approach ignores the compounding nature of technical debt and architectural disruption. A seemingly simple authentication feature requires database schema modifications, session management protocols, and security auditing. Each of these components demands dedicated development hours.
The financial impact extends beyond initial coding time. Testing frameworks must expand to cover new authentication pathways. Deployment pipelines require configuration adjustments. Third-party service tiers may need upgrading to accommodate additional user accounts. Content production workflows must also adapt to support member-only areas. These hidden dependencies consistently erode profit margins when left unanalyzed. What Is the Four-Way Classification System?
The classification framework divides incoming modifications into four distinct operational categories. The first category encompasses trivial adjustments that require less than one hour of development time. These items should be absorbed as visible goodwill rather than billed immediately. Transparent goodwill functions as a strategic retainer tool rather than an uncontrolled expense. Clients appreciate predictable boundaries when minor requests arise during active development cycles.
The second category addresses minor adjustments that warrant standard hourly billing. This approach eliminates negotiation friction while maintaining accurate financial tracking. The third category identifies scoped features that require dedicated specifications and formal quotations. Authentication implementations frequently fall into this category due to their architectural complexity. The final category captures scope changes that fundamentally alter the original agreement. These modifications demand contract renegotiation rather than hourly billing. Hourly compensation for scope changes implicitly invalidates the initial contract terms. This classification structure forces deliberate decision-making before work begins.
How Does Technical Analysis Prevent Margin Erosion?
Accurate estimation requires tracing the actual blast radius within the existing codebase. Developers must examine how new features interact with established architecture rather than relying on industry averages. The most expensive components of any modification remain invisible to clients who lack technical context. Schema migrations often introduce data integrity risks that require extensive validation. Authentication implementations affect pages that previously operated under public access assumptions. Existing functionality may break when session states change unexpectedly.
Third-party platform limits frequently trigger additional licensing costs that fall outside the original budget. Content production requirements expand when member areas require dedicated copywriting and media assets. Testing and deployment phases must be explicitly itemized during estimation. Unwritten testing requirements consistently become unpaid labor. A robust estimation process includes subtask breakdowns, hour ranges, and a one-point-five times multiplier ceiling. This mathematical approach accounts for unforeseen technical complications while maintaining pricing transparency.
Why Does Response Protocol Matter in Client Relations?
Professional communication during scope modifications establishes long-term business sustainability. The recommended response strategy prioritizes factual clarity over defensive justification. A single paragraph should outline the technical requirements, financial implications, and timeline adjustments. This approach positions the service provider as a helpful expert rather than a reluctant contractor. Clear documentation prevents misaligned expectations during complex development phases.
When modifications conflict with established specifications, referencing the original document maintains professional boundaries. The initial agreement exists precisely to manage mid-project alterations. Asking a single clarifying question forces the client to engage with the financial and temporal consequences of their request. This technique transforms casual requests into deliberate business decisions. The systematic evaluation process ultimately protects both profit margins and project quality. How Does Authentication Architecture Influence Project Budgeting?
Authentication implementations require careful architectural planning before development begins. Professionals must determine whether the system needs simple email verification or comprehensive multi-factor authentication. Each option carries distinct technical requirements and financial implications. Basic email verification involves minimal database modifications and straightforward session management. Advanced authentication systems require password reset workflows, account recovery protocols, and security audit trails. These components demand specialized development hours that significantly impact project budgets. Understanding these technical distinctions allows professionals to provide accurate quotations.
The technical complexity of authentication directly correlates with long-term maintenance costs. Systems that lack proper security foundations require frequent patches and updates. Professionals who skip architectural planning often face expensive refactoring later in the development cycle. Proper planning during the estimation phase prevents costly technical debt accumulation.
